Croton plants, with their brightly colored foliage, originate from the warm, humid climates of the Pacific Islands, Malaysia, and Indonesia. This tropical heritage means they are not adapted to significant environmental shifts, making temperature a primary factor in their health. Their sensitivity requires understanding their needs to keep the leaves vibrant and prevent common issues like leaf loss.
For crotons to flourish indoors, they require a stable temperature that mimics their native tropical environment. The optimal range is between 60 and 85 degrees Fahrenheit (15 to 29°C). Maintaining temperatures within this bracket encourages lush growth and the development of rich, varied colors. Temperatures should not dip below 60°F (15°C), their lower tolerance threshold.
These plants prefer consistency, as sudden temperature fluctuations can cause a stress reaction, often leading to leaf drop. Avoid placing them where they will experience rapid changes, such as near a door that is frequently opened to the cold. A stable environment contributes to the plant’s vigor and the intensity of its leaf coloration.
Exposure to temperatures below 60°F (15°C) can cause significant distress for a croton, with the most common symptom being the sudden loss of leaves. The plant may drop a significant portion of its foliage in a short period. This reaction occurs because the plant is trying to conserve energy to survive unfavorable conditions.
Before the leaves drop, you might notice other indicators of cold stress. The vibrant reds, yellows, and oranges in the foliage can become dull, and the edges of the leaves may begin to turn brown and dry. The leaves themselves might also appear wilted or limp, even if the soil is properly moist.
Even a brief exposure to temperatures below 50°F (10°C) can be detrimental, prompting leaf loss and potentially harming the plant’s root system. The plant is attempting to protect its core by shedding its extremities. If you observe these signs, move the plant to a warmer, more stable location.
While crotons are tropical, they are not immune to excessive heat. When temperatures climb above their 85°F (29°C) limit, the plant will show signs of stress. A primary symptom is wilting, where the leaves droop as the plant loses moisture faster than its roots can absorb it. This is often accompanied by leaf scorch, which appears as dry, brown patches on the foliage.
Prolonged exposure to high temperatures can also negatively affect the plant’s coloration. The colors may appear faded or washed out, as intense heat and light can degrade the pigments in the leaves. High heat also increases the plant’s rate of transpiration, requiring more frequent watering to avoid dehydration.
To prevent temperature-related stress, thoughtful placement and seasonal adjustments are necessary. During winter, move crotons away from sources of cold drafts like drafty windowsills, doors leading outside, and uninsulated walls. Keep them away from direct proximity to heating vents or radiators, as the dry, hot air can be just as damaging.
In summer, if you move your croton outdoors, choose a location that receives partial shade, especially during the hottest part of the afternoon. Direct sun can overheat the plant. For indoor plants, an east-facing window that provides bright morning light is a good choice. Adjusting the plant’s location with the seasons provides the stable environment it needs to thrive.
